What is Short-Form Video Content?

Short-form video content is about creating brief, engaging videos that capture attention quickly. These videos have become immensely popular with the rise of social media and smartphones. They are usually just a few seconds to a few minutes long, making them perfect for our fast-paced world.

The beauty of short-form videos lies in their ability to entertain and convey messages effectively. They often feature catchy music, eye-catching visuals, and concise storytelling. Whether showcasing products, sharing tutorials, or providing behind-the-scenes glimpses, these videos deliver information compactly and entertainingly.

Platforms like TikTok, Instagram Reels, and YouTube Shorts have propelled the popularity of short-form video content even further. They offer a space for creativity and allow individuals and businesses to reach a wide audience. These highly shareable videos can quickly go viral, making them a powerful tool for connecting with your audience.

1. User-Generated Content (UGC)

UGC stands for User-Generated Content. It refers to content that is created and shared by everyday users rather than professional creators or brands. In the context of short-form videos, UGC refers to videos that are produced by individuals or communities, often using platforms like TikTok, Instagram Reels, or Snapchat.

User-generated content has gained tremendous popularity in recent years, transforming how we consume and interact with digital media. It has become a driving force behind the success of many social media platforms, as it allows users to express themselves creatively and engage with others more authentically and personally.

One noteworthy example of UGC’s impact is the “In My Feelings” challenge on Instagram. It all started when a user uploaded a video of themselves dancing to Drake’s song “In My Feelings.” The challenge quickly went viral, with people from all walks of life joining in and putting their own spin on the dance routine. It became a cultural phenomenon, generating millions of views and inspiring countless variations.

UGC has revolutionized how we consume and engage with short-form videos, giving everyone a platform to share their creativity and be part of a larger community. It’s an exciting trend to keep up with in 2023 and beyond!

3. Brand Challenges

Do Brand Challenges For Your Short-Form Video ContentBranded hashtag challenges involve companies creating a unique hashtag and encouraging users to create and share videos using that hashtag. It’s an excellent opportunity for brands to tap into the creativity of their target audience and generate user-generated content that promotes their brand organically.

A prime example of a successful branded hashtag challenge was the #InMyDenim campaign by Guess. They invited users to showcase their personal style and creativity by wearing their favourite denim and creating videos with the hashtag.

This challenge quickly gained momentum, and before you knew it, people from all walks of life were jumping on the trend and sharing their unique denim looks. This increased brand visibility and created a sense of community among Guess fans.

So, if you’re a brand looking to make a splash in 2023, consider incorporating branded hashtag challenges into your marketing strategy. They’re an effective way to connect with your audience, promote your brand, and harness the incredible creativity of social media users.

Best Platforms For Short-Form Video Content

Short-form video content has gained immense popularity in the digital media and social networking era. With attention spans shrinking and users seeking quick and engaging content, platforms like TikTok, Instagram Reels, and YouTube Shorts have emerged as the best options for creators and consumers alike.

1. TikTok

Tiktok for Posting Short-Form VideosTikTok, a Chinese social media platform, has taken the world by storm with its addictive and creative short videos. With a vast user base of 1.05 billion active users, TikTok allows creators to reach a global audience and gain instant popularity. And a highly sophisticated algorithm, TikTok allows creators to reach a global audience and gain instant popularity.

The platform’s unique features, such as sound effects, filters, and editing tools, enable users to produce high-quality content easily. TikTok’s emphasis on virality and discoverability makes it an ideal platform for aspiring and established content creators.

 

2. Instagram Reels

IG reels For Posting Short-Form VideosInstagram Reels, introduced as a direct competitor to TikTok, has become an integral part of the Instagram experience. With its user-friendly interface and integration within the Instagram app, Reels allows creators to showcase their talent to their existing followers while reaching a massive user base of 1.628 billion through the Explore page.

The platform offers a range of creative tools and effects, making it simple to produce engaging and visually appealing short videos. Moreover, Instagram’s strong influencer culture and diverse user base make Reels an attractive platform for content creators looking to collaborate and monetize their content.

 

3. YouTube Shorts

Youtube Shorts For Posting Short-Form VideosYouTube, the world’s largest video-sharing platform, recently launched YouTube Shorts in response to the rising demand for short-form video content. With its vast user base of 1.5 billion monthly active users and established creator community, YouTube Shorts provides a unique opportunity for content creators to leverage their existing subscriber base and gain visibility.

The platform’s monetization options, such as the YouTube Partner Program, offer creators the potential to generate revenue from their Shorts content. Additionally, YouTube Shorts benefits from the platform’s robust search and recommendation algorithm, increasing the chances of content discovery and viewership.
